About This Software

The Sapphire HD 5570 1GB DDR3 is a reliable graphics card that requires proper drivers for optimal functionality. These drivers ensure your graphics card communicates effectively with your operating system, enabling smooth performance, better visual quality, and enhanced gaming experiences. Regular driver updates can fix bugs, improve stability, and unlock new features for your graphics card. Downloading the latest drivers is essential for maintaining peak performance and preventing compatibility issues with newer software titles.

How to Use

First, identify your operating system version (Windows 7, 8, 10, or 11). Download the appropriate driver package from our verified sources. Run the installer and follow the on-screen instructions. After installation, restart your computer to complete the setup process.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which version of Windows is compatible with the HD 5570 driver?

The Sapphire HD 5570 drivers support Windows 7, 8, 10, and 11 operating systems. Make sure to download the correct version for your system.

How often should I update my graphics card drivers?

It's recommended to check for driver updates every 2-3 months or when you experience performance issues, encounter new bugs, or install new software that requires updated drivers.

What should I do if the driver installation fails?

First, uninstall any existing graphics drivers using DDU (Display Driver Uninstaller) in safe mode, then restart your computer and attempt a clean installation of the new drivers.
